From One Screen to Another – Why the Move is Making Headlines
Ukkola's departure from a major commercial TV channel earlier this year didn't go unnoticed. Many viewers remember her tough interviews and precise, on-the-mark analysis. Now, she's making her public comeback with this particular media outlet, a move that has some political observers raising an eyebrow while others eagerly await the result. The new platform is known for its distinct political leanings, but Ukkola's style has never fit neatly into a box – she challenges both left and right, which is precisely what positions The Sanna Ukkola Show as potentially one of autumn's most compelling talk shows.
What's on the Show?
The show's format is simple but effective: Ukkola invites one or two key influencers as guests, and then they get down to business. Expect direct questions, sharp commentary, and that same spirited, no-holds-barred approach Ukkola is known for. The first episode will feature a politician whose name has been doing the rounds for the past week – insider sources hint it's one of the most recognisable voices in parliament.
- Topics: The fallout from the social welfare and healthcare (sote) reform, the ongoing sparring between the government and opposition, and definitely the ripple effects of the war in Ukraine on Finland.
- Guests: Expect names from various political parties, but also experts from the worlds of economics and culture – and even a few surprise names from behind the scenes.
- Ukkola's Approach: Not afraid to ask the tough questions, never shy with criticism, but also knows when to laugh.
